Subject: Re: [ 60/76] drm/nouveau/bios: fix shadowing of ACPI ROMs larger
 than 64KiB

On 19.10.2012, Greg Kroah-Hartman wrote: 

> 3.6-stable review patch.  If anyone has any objections, please let me know.

While 3.6.2 is fine. 3.6.3-rc1 crashes my machine (Asus U45-JC) at
boot. A screenshot of the output is here:

http://www.fritha.org/crash.jpg

Reverting this one fixes it:

> Ben Skeggs <bskeggs@...hat.com>
>     drm/nouveau/bios: fix shadowing of ACPI ROMs larger than 64KiB
